Green tea is good for you and has lots of antioxidants etc and I have at least one cup a day but I only buy healtheries green tea which is caffeine free so go and buy this one kobec.
Parki Robitussin is meant to help thin out cervical mucus making what cm you do have more thin and stretchy. There is a website www.fertilityplus.org that explains about what sort of Robitussin to look for what days to take etc.
Acupuncture is very good for helping to balance the body for conception, helped me along with clomid to conceive my daughter.

Posted By: AngieBabe
Date Posted: 05 February 2008 at 10:54am
When I did the Robitussin thing I got the one that has Guiphenisen (sp) as the active ingredient as that is what thins the mucous... also took the recommended dose on the bottle three times a day (as that's what I was told to do when the whole theory was explained to me).
Also with the pillow tilt... I have heard that if you have a uterus that's tilted the opposite way to what is considered norm (sorry, can't remember the technical term) then it can sometimes be better to flip and lie on your belly... I don't think I have an oddly tipped uterus but I definitely do notice less 'leakage' ( sorry TMI) when I do this.
